The general theory of relativity has allowed a better understanding of the structure of the universe. One of the fundamental problems in the general relativity is finding exact solutions of the Einstein field equations. Some solutions found fundamental applications ins astrophysics, cosmology and more recently in the developments inspired by string theory. Different mathematical formulations that allow to solve Einstein´s field equations have been used to describe the behaviour of objects submitted to strong gravitational fields known as neutron stars, quasars, and white dwarfs. General relativity also allows the analysis, through Einstein’s gravity theory, of different cosmological scenarios as the existence of dark energy, dark matter, Phantom and Quintessence fields that were introduced to explain the accelerated expansion of the universe. An astronomical object or celestial object is a naturally occurring physical entity or structure that exists in the universe.
